Myrtle tree removal services involve the careful and efficient process of eliminating mature myrtle trees from residential or commercial properties. These services typically include assessing the tree’s size, health, and location, followed by safely cutting and removing the tree while minimizing impact on surrounding structures or landscaping. Professional contractors often use specialized equipment to handle the job safely and effectively, ensuring that the tree is removed without causing damage to nearby property elements. This service is essential when a tree has become hazardous or is no longer viable, requiring expert handling to prevent accidents or property damage.

Removing a myrtle tree can help resolve several common problems faced by property owners. Overgrown or unhealthy trees may pose safety risks, such as falling branches or the entire tree becoming unstable during storms. Additionally, trees that are too close to buildings can interfere with utility lines, block sunlight, or cause damage to foundations and sidewalks through root growth. In some cases, a tree may be diseased or infested with pests, making removal the safest option to protect the health of other plants and trees on the property. Myrtle tree removal services provide a practical solution to these issues, helping to maintain a safe and attractive outdoor space.

The overview below groups typical Myrtle Tree Removal proj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Scottsdale, AZ.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Small Tree Removal - typical costs range from $250-$600 for many smaller jobs like removing a single tree or trimming branches. Most routine projects fall within this middle range, with fewer jobs reaching the higher end of the spectrum.

Medium Tree Removal - larger trees or multiple trees can cost between $600-$1,500 depending on size and location. These projects are common for residential properties needing significant clearance or removal.

Large Tree Removal - extensive or mature trees often cost $1,500-$3,000, especially when equipment access is limited. Projects in this range are less frequent but necessary for safety or property management.

Full Tree Removal & Stump Grinding - comprehensive services including stump removal can range from $300-$5,000+ based on tree size and site complexity. Larger, more complex projects can reach higher costs, but most fall within moderate tiers.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are the signs that a Myrtle tree needs to be removed? Indicators include dead or dying branches, structural instability, or significant damage from pests or storms that compromise the tree's safety and health.

Is it necessary to remove a Myrtle tree if it is close to my property? Yes, proximity to structures or utility lines can pose risks, and removal may be recommended to prevent potential damage or hazards.

What methods do local contractors use to remove Myrtle trees? They typically employ techniques such as tree cutting, dismantling in sections, or stump grinding, depending on the size and location of the tree.

Are there any permits required for Myrtle tree removal in Scottsdale, AZ? Permit requirements vary by local regulations, so consulting with local service providers can help determine if permits are necessary before removal.
